The place on a BALLOT where the voter is instructed to ma rk her preference for a candidate or question. N. M. Admin. Code §1.10.12.7(T). Also “voting response field” or VOTING TARGET. Wyo. Sec’y of State Rule 1570, §4(nnn). Voting Rights Act of 1965 A sweeping civil rights statute that eliminated various devices used to bar groups from exercising their right to vote. Among its requirements was mandatory provision for multi- lingual ballots. 42 U. S. C. §1973–1973aa-6. Abbreviated VRA.
